About The Position

This role involves working directly with a Foreman to learn and execute the planning, lay-out, installation, testing, repair, or maintenance of high voltage substation wiring, electrical fixtures, apparatus, motors, forms, rebar, embeds and anchor bolts, equipment, and control systems. The position requires learning to plan and coordinate the efforts of craft workers under supervision, motivating them to achieve work safely, correctly, and efficiently. Requirements

  • Must have working experience as a Substation Journeyman or equivalent combination of education and experience in an industrial construction setting.
  • Strong working knowledge of the project specifications and high voltage electrical and civil industry standards.
  • Must have working knowledge of electrical substation components, fabrication and erection of forms with thorough knowledge of steel framed forms (i.e. Symons).
  • Must have thorough knowledge of rebar fabrication and placement including proper tying techniques.
  • Must have thorough knowledge of placing, finishing and sealing concrete.
  • Must have thorough knowledge of the construction, testing, maintenance, and repair of substations.

Responsibilities

  • Perform all of the principal duties and accountabilities of craft workers under his/her supervision.
  • Lead and support all safety related processes and programs as requested.
  • Engage with your work team to ensure we achieve zero injuries.
  • Watch for hazards and report any concerns to your supervisor or safety professional.
  • Use stop work authority until an issue is resolved if needed.
  • Create and execute a one week schedule.
  • Review crew's timecards for correct hours and activity designation.
  • Report all accidents and near misses to supervisor and participate in investigation process as needed.
  • Lead, complete, and sign off on daily pre-job safety planning in the appropriate format.
  • Identify safety hazards and take all necessary corrective action to eliminate or mitigate them.
  • Assure all crew members understand, participate, and sign all pre-job safety planning tools at start and end of shift.
  • Understand and respond appropriately to all safety hazards and warning devices.
  • Understand, support, implement, and follow lockout/tag out procedures.
  • Attend site specific training and assure you follow all procedures as outlined in training.
  • Follow established safety rules and regulations and maintain a safe and clean work environment.
  • Use effective verbal and written communication skills.
  • Add, subtract, multiply and divide whole numbers and fractions rapidly and accurately.
  • Listen to other co-workers and supervisor's suggestions, concerns and recommendations, asking questions and providing feedback when appropriate.
  • Report information to Foreman.
  • Coordinate and communicate work with other crafts and co-workers on the job.
  • Provide on-the-job training to individuals under his/her supervision.
  • Train/teach safety practices, policies and procedures related to an employee's assigned tasks.
  • Receive training on administrative duties which include filling out daily reports, material requisitions, coordinating equipment and suppliers etc.
  • Perform task planning to safely and efficiently carry out all aspects of assigned work.
  • Plan and communicate with supervisor to assure that an adequate supply of tools, materials and equipment are available.
  • Gain a complete understanding of the scope of work and the related parts of the project.
  • Develop a thorough understanding of the project plans, specifications and schedule as they relate to that portion of the work assigned.
